This typeface is built from crisp, geometric skeletons with extreme thick–thin modulation and clean, unbracketed terminals. The uppercase shows broad, sculpted forms with generous sidebearings and a distinctly display-oriented rhythm, while the lowercase keeps a relatively conventional structure with compact joins and sharp entry/exit points. Curves are smooth and taut, counters are open, and stress reads as largely vertical, producing a polished, contemporary look. Numerals echo the same contrast and rounded bowl construction, with elegant transitions into hairline strokes.
Best suited to display settings where its contrast and wide proportions can breathe—magazine heads and decks, fashion/beauty branding, premium packaging, and poster typography. It also works well for short, high-impact statements and logotype-style wordmarks where refined detail is desirable.
The overall tone feels luxurious and editorial, with a poised, high-fashion brightness created by the hairline details and expansive letterforms. It communicates confidence and sophistication, leaning more toward runway headlines and magazine typography than utilitarian interface text.
The design appears intended as a contemporary, contrast-forward display face that evokes classic high-contrast elegance while maintaining clean, modern construction. It prioritizes striking silhouettes and refined thin strokes to deliver a premium, editorial presence.
Hairline horizontals and thin diagonals become prominent features, especially in letters like A, K, V, W, and the cross strokes in E/F/T, giving the design a sparkling, high-definition character. The wide stance and pronounced contrast create strong word shapes at large sizes, but also make spacing and line breaks visually assertive.
